Abstract This study intends to present and demonstrate the city of Dar es Salaam as an example of cities in Developing countries which originated from multi-colonial settings for centuries. This study demonstr...ates various colonial policies and regulations which were set for the interest of colonial administration, hence clarifying how the policies influenced the evolving process of the city of Dar es Salaam and its growth. The study analyzes the sub-division of three zones in the city which were plarmed under segregation policies. As a result, we clarify how the planning mechanism resulted into the various shortcomings which led to the physical planning of the city.
